Output e5892679948f25319d94c79af0dae9882e2814cd46a8db811563b544aa0fa634:20

value
2637598
script pubkey
OP_0 OP_PUSHBYTES_20 23d24b504eeedfbfc4a3adec2cafa8755c2d4608
address
bc1qy0fyk5zwam0ml39r4hkzetagw4wz63sg0cnlma
transaction
e5892679948f25319d94c79af0dae9882e2814cd46a8db811563b544aa0fa634
spent
true